Tempus is a leader in advancing precision medicine through the practical application of artificial intelligence in healthcare. We are seeking a driven and strategic Director of Business Development to drive commercial sales for our AI Products Business unit with a focus on our multi-modal AI and technology portfolio solutions.

The Business Development Director will identify and pursue new business opportunities, develop and maintain a robust pipeline of prospects and potential customers, and own accounts from lead generation and qualification to proposal writing and deal closure. This role will work with the Paige team and cross functionally with a broad range of stakeholders and will require a strong understanding of the biopharma life cycle. In addition to possessing robust business development skills, ideal candidates will be collaborative, agile team players eager to address and solve significant challenges within the digital pathology, oncology, and biopharma sectors.  

Key Responsibilities:

  • Drive New Business: Identify and secure new commercial opportunities with Life Sciences partners for Tempus’s AI Products business unit, with a focus on our AI and technology portfolio solutions in the imaging and genomics space, including digital pathology  

  • Your day-to-day efforts will include but are not limited to client outreach, development and delivery of materials tailored to the client’s needs, client pitches, proposal / SOW writing, and contract negotiations.

  • Consultative, Value-Based Selling: Move beyond feature-based selling to articulate a compelling "Why Tempus?" narrative. Focus on the partner’s critical business pain and quantify the transformational impact our solutions deliver.

  • Strategic Account Planning: Become an expert in the partner’s strategy, pipeline and portfolio to proactively determine opportunities where our AI and technology solutions could be leveraged for solving key client challenges.  

  • Relationship Management: Build and maintain relationships with key executives, strategy and innovation leads, clinical development heads, and program and assets teams.

  • Rigorous Deal Qualification and Sales Execution: Qualify opportunities, ensuring a focus on deals with a high probability of success. You will be expected to identify and engage the Economic Buyer early, build and test champions, and understand the complete decision and contracting process.

  • Team-Based Selling: Collaborate closely with internal teams including Product, Engineering, AI Scientists, and Medical teams to present tailored solutions as a unified front to the customer, ensuring technical buy-in and smooth contract execution.

  • Pipeline Management: Build and manage a robust sales pipeline in SFDC, providing accurate forecasting and consistently meeting or exceeding revenue targets.

Qualifications & Experience:

  • Required:

    • 5+ years of demonstrated success in a business development or enterprise sales role within the Life Sciences, biopharma, or health-tech industries.

    • Background or strong knowledge of oncology, science, or medical fields

    • Deep understanding of the pharmaceutical R&D and commercialization lifecycle.

    • Kind, collaborative, and agile teammate with a desire to tackle and solve meaningful problems within the digital pathology, oncology, and biopharma space

    • Proven track record of exceeding annual sales targets and experience closing complex, multi-year partnerships, service or platform deals.

    • Demonstrated ability to establish credibility and build trusted relationships with clients

    • Outstanding communication and presentation skills, with the ability to engage credibly with scientific and executive-level audiences.

    • Proactive and adept problem solver with strong prioritization, execution, and critical thinking skills 

  • Preferred:

    • Existing relationships within top 20 pharmaceutical companies

    • Experience working in the Digital Pathology and/or modern AI fields (eg, understanding of Foundation Models, AI development)
